💸Daily Money Saving Tip💸

To tackle your credit card debt, consider the snowball method. Start by paying off the credit card with the smallest balance first, then move on to the next smallest balance, and so on. This approach can help you gain momentum and motivation as you see your debts disappearing one by one. Remember to make payments on time and avoid adding new debt while you're working to pay off what you already owe.

Top 5 ways to decrease debt...

1. Create a Budget: Creating and sticking to a budget is one of the most effective ways to decrease your debt. Start by tracking your income and expenses, and identify areas where you can cut back on spending. This could mean reducing the amount you spend on entertainment, dining out, or clothing. By prioritizing your spending, you can allocate more money towards paying off your debt each month.

2. Prioritize Your Debts: Make a list of all your debts and prioritize them in order of interest rate. Then, focus on paying off the debts with the highest interest rate first. By doing so, you'll reduce the amount of interest you'll pay in the long run, which can help you pay off your debt faster.

3. Negotiate with Creditors: If you're struggling to make your payments, reach out to your creditors and see if you can negotiate a lower interest rate or a payment plan that fits your budget. Many creditors are willing to work with you if you're upfront and honest about your financial situation.

4. Consolidate Your Debt: If you have multiple debts with high interest rates, consolidating them into one loan with a lower interest rate can help you save money and simplify your payments. This can be done through a personal loan, a balance transfer credit card, or a home equity loan.

5. Increase Your Income: Consider ways to earn extra income, such as taking on a part-time job or freelancing. This extra money can be put towards paying off your debt faster. Additionally, you can look for ways to earn passive income, such as renting out a spare room or selling items you no longer need. The more money you can put towards paying off your debt, the faster you'll be able to become debt-free.
